 Father

In the quiet moments of twilight's grace,

A silhouette emerges, a familiar face.

Strong and steady, yet gentle and kind,

A beacon of wisdom, a fortress of mind.


With calloused hands and eyes that gleam,

He guides with love through life's vast stream.

A silent hero in the shadows cast,

His presence, a tether, steadfast and fast.


In childhood's days, his arms would sway,

Lifting high, where worries would sway.

A protector, a provider, a guardian true,

His love, an endless river, forever anew.


Through laughter and tears, he stands by,

A pillar of strength beneath the sky.

His words, a melody, a soothing balm,

In the stormy seas, a guiding calm.


In moments of triumph, he shares the joy,

A cheerleader, a mentor, never coy.

And in defeat, he offers a hand,

To lift us up, to help us stand.


His sacrifices, often unseen,

A silent symphony, a selfless sheen.

For every dream he sets aside,

To see us soar, to watch us stride.


As time unfurls its relentless art,

Lines etched deep, a map of the heart.

Yet his spirit, undaunted, remains,

A beacon of hope through life's refrains.


So here's to the fathers, steadfast and true,

Whose love knows no bounds, forever anew.

In every heartbeat, in every breath,

Their legacy lives on, even after death.
